The answer to 'how much does window cost local' is that the cost of window cleaning services can vary significantly depending on your local market and a number of factors. In general, window cleaning prices tend to range from $3 to $15 per window, with the average cost being around $5-$10 per window.

The key factors that influence the cost of window cleaning include the size and number of windows, the accessibility and difficulty of the job, the location and cost of living in your area, and the experience and pricing of local window cleaning companies. Getting quotes from multiple local providers is essential to understanding the typical rates in your neighborhood.

Is it cheaper to do window cleaning myself?

For most homeowners, it's generally more cost-effective to hire a professional window cleaning service rather than do it yourself, especially for multi-story homes or hard-to-reach windows.

How often should I get my windows cleaned?

Most experts recommend getting your home's windows cleaned 1-2 times per year, depending on factors like climate, window exposure, and how dirty they get.

What additional services do window cleaners offer?

Many window cleaning companies also provide additional services like gutter cleaning, power washing, and screen repair or replacement for an added cost.
